The Copenhagen diet and other diets The Copenhagen diet is a thirteen-day, very strict weight loss diet . It owes its name to the claim that it was developed by doctors from one of the clinics in Copenhagen. To what extent is this true? It is difficult to say, although given the fact that this diet definitely contradicts common sense and has little to do with real dietetics, it also has little to do with common weight loss . Why? This is determined by the rigour of the diet . Limitation of the amount of food In fact, by staying on a diet Copenhagen , we provide the body with so little food, and in addition, so little variety, that it is not surprising that the body starts to rebel at some point. He rebels to such an extent that he slows down his metabolism, which in turn makes slimming more and more difficult. Over time, it may even become impossible.
